Installasjon og vedlikehold av ventilasjonsanlegg

Bergen kommune - Byrådsavdeling for næring, kultur og idrett needs ventilation services for a framework agreement over 4 years, with a maximum total value of 10 million NOK. The services include maintenance, repair, renovation, installation, expansion, alteration, adjustment, measurement, and cleaning of ventilation installations and channels in buildings owned or managed by the Agency for Housing Management (EBF) in Vestland. The tenderer must have sufficient technical resources and capacity, and key personnel must have relevant experience and professional qualifications. Additionally, the tenderer must have a certified quality management system (e.g., ISO 9001) and an environmental management system (e.g., Eco-lighthouse, EMAS, or ISO 14001).

    Framework agreement for ventilation services for Bergen municipality c/o the Agency for Housing Management (EBF). The framework agreement is for the execution of work connected to ventilation in buildings that the Contracting Authority owns or is responsible for. The framework agreement is for the execution of work connected to ventilation in buildings that the Contracting Authority owns or is responsible for. EBF has organised its portfolio in approx. 700 objects, which in turn consists of approx. 1,750+ street addresses with a total of approx. 5,650+ rental units. Typical assignments included in the contract (not an exhaustive list) :* Delivery of filters and belts, with and without filter replacement* Services in the maintenance and repair of ventilation installations* Renovation or installation of ventilation systems* Expansion and alteration of existing ventilation channels* Adjustment and measurement of CO2* Cleaning of ventilation installations and ventilation channels,Samt other works that naturally come under the framework agreement. Most of the ventilation installations are located inside the tenant ́s flats, and the tenderer must agree access with the individual tenant. Projects where ventilation services are included as a natural part of the total delivery is not a part of the framework agreement.

Kvalifikasjonskrav 1

The tenderer is registered in a company register or a trade register in the member state in which the tenderer is established. As described in annex XI of directive 2014/24/EU; suppliers from certain member states may have to fulfil other requirements in the mentioned annex. Minimum qualification requirements Tenderers shall be a legally registered company. Documentation: Documentation: Documentation must not be enclosed for tenderers registered in the Norwegian Register of Units. The contracting authority will check the registration by using the organisation number stated in the tenderer ́s Mercell profile. Tenderers who are not registered in the above register must present a certificate or confirmation (equivalent company registration certificate) for registration in a trade or business register as prescribed by the law of the country where the tenderer is established. Such a certificate shall not be issued more than six months before the tender deadline.
Kvalifikasjonskrav 2

Regarding any other economic and financial requirements that have been stated in the notice or in the procurement documents, the tenderer declares that: Minimum qualification requirements The tenderer has sufficient economic and financial capacity to fulfil the contract. Documentation for Norwegian tenderers: The contracting authority will check the tenderer ́s financial situation itself from Proff Forvalt (https://forvalt.no/) and/or via information provided by Creditsafe (https://www.creditsafe.com) and can obtain further information from the Brønnøysund Register Centre. Tenderers are required to have a minimum rating B (moderate risk) in Creditsafe and/or Proff Forvalt. Foreign companies: The contracting authority will check the tenderer ́s financial situation itself from Creditsafe and/or Proff Forvalt. If the tenderer is not registered in Creditsafe and/or Proff Forvalt ́s registers, the company ́s last two auditor approved annual accounts must be submitted upon request. If information in the above sources is not correct or supplementary information is needed to highlight the company's economic and financial situation, this can be provided.
Kvalifikasjonskrav 3

Tenderers can use the following technical personnel or technical units, particularly those who are responsible for quality control: For technical personnel or technical units that do not directly belong to the tenderer ́s business, but if the capacity the tenderer will use, cf. part II, section C, separate ESPD forms shall be supplemented. Minimum qualification requirements Tenderers are required to have sufficient technical resources and the capacity to carry out the assignment in accordance with the contracting authority ́s needs. Documentation: Tenderers shall enclose an overview of personnel with technical/professional competence that are relevant for the execution of this delivery. The overview shall include the person ́s professional qualifications, experience and how the person is intended to be used in the relevant delivery. All resources stated shall have sufficient capacity in the contract period to be able to be used as described. Examples of such documentation include an organisation chart, staffing plan or delivery organisation.
Kvalifikasjonskrav 4

The following education and professional qualifications are possessed by the tenderer and/or (depending on the requirements set in the notice or in the procurement documents) of the leading employees: Minimum qualification requirements Tenderers shall have sufficient competence and professional qualifications to manage and quality assure the delivery. Documentation: Tenderers shall enclose an overview of what experience and professional qualifications are possessed by key personnel who will be responsible for the delivery. The documentation shall include the following information: Name. Role/position in the tenderer's company. Education and other professional qualifications. Number of years with relevant experience. A brief description of relevant experience. An example of such documentation is CVs for key personnel connected to the agreement.
Kvalifikasjonskrav 5

Can tenderers submit certificates issued by independent bodies that document that the tenderer fulfils the stated quality assurance standards, including universal design requirements? Minimum qualification requirements The contracting authority requires that all tenderers have implemented a certified quality management system that is satisfactory to ensure the quality of the execution of this contract. Documentation requirement: Certificate issued by an independent body that is certified for certification. The certificate must confirm that the tenderer's quality management system complies with requirements in a relevant European standard, for example ISO 9001. If a tenderer does not have such a certificate, the tenderer must provide other documentation for quality assurance measures that are equivalent to a relevant European quality assurance standard. Tenderers must also document that the measures are equivalent to those required in accordance with such quality assurance standard.
Kvalifikasjonskrav 6

Is the tenderer able to submit certificates issued by independent bodies as documentation that the tenderer fulfils the stated environmental management systems or standards? Minimum qualification requirements The contracting authority requires that all tenderers have implemented procedures and systems, certified by independent third parties, that ensure that the execution of this contract has a low impact on the environment. Documentation requirement: Certificate issued by an independent body that is certified for certification. The certificate must confirm that the tenderer's environmental management system complies with requirements in a relevant standard. Documentation is required that the tenderer either has an Eco-lighthouse certificate, is EMAS certified, is certified in accordance with ISO 14001, or have a valid certificate from other relevant environmental management schemes or standards. If a tenderer does not have such a certificate, the tenderer must provide other documentation for environmental management measures that are equivalent to a relevant environmental management scheme or standard. Tenderers must also document that the measures are equivalent to those required in accordance with such an environmental management scheme or standard. Tenderers who are qualified on the basis of other documentation for environmental management measures than the third-party certification that is awarded the contract, will be obliged to carry out third-party certification of their environmental management system. This is further described in the contractual requirements that are included in the annex for changes to the standard contract.
